Output 89d8c265a938b8433558bb759fa773b2628d8e035a01b637e27e4c80761cdb26:41

value
236380681
script pubkey
OP_0 OP_PUSHBYTES_20 751205065c79935e69757c9389fd9b672179901b
address
bc1qw5fq2pju0xf4u6t40jfcnlvmvushnyqm9nguj0
transaction
89d8c265a938b8433558bb759fa773b2628d8e035a01b637e27e4c80761cdb26
spent
true